氯离子环境下工业污水处理厂金属腐蚀机理及防护策略

Abstract:Againstthe backdropof therapiddevelopmentof industrializationinChina,thestableoperationof industrialwastewatertreatment plants isthekeytoachievingthestandarddischargeof wastewater.However,thecorrosion of metal structures caused by high-concentration chloride ions in the industrial wastewater treatment process has become a major hidden danger restricting their normal operation.This paper analyzes the corrosion mechanism of chlorideions on metal materials,focuses on several common corrosion forms in industrial wastewater treatment systems, including pitingcorrosion,crevicecorrosion,galvaniccorrosionand stresscorrosion,and further explores theeffects of key factors such as chloride ion concentration,temperature, pH value ,flow rate and microbial concentration on the corrosionrate.Finally,combined withtheactual operating conditionsof industrial wastewater treatment plants,chloride ioncorrosion-resistantprotection strategiessuitablefordiferentworkingonditionsareproposed,aiming toprovidetheoretical reference for the metal protectionof industrial wastewater treatment plants inchloride ionenvironments.
